The Nose Knows: Odor as a Mold Detector
A musty, earthy smell is a classic sign of hidden mold. This odor is caused by microbial volatile organic compounds (MVOCs) released as mold digests organic materials like wood or drywall.
If the smell persists after cleaning, it’s likely embedded in porous materials. This is common in water-damaged areas of South River or Sayrewood, where past flooding or leaks went unaddressed.
Use your phone’s flashlight to inspect dark corners of closets, behind furniture, and under sinks. Mold often starts in these low-light, high-moisture zones.

DIY Mold Detection Tools and Techniques
A moisture meter helps identify damp areas where mold is likely. Readings above 17% in wood or drywall signal trouble. These are essential for basements in East Franklin or Dayton.
Borescopes allow you to inspect inside walls or ducts without demolition. Thermal imaging cameras reveal temperature differences that indicate moisture—useful in older homes near Madison Park or Pleasant Plains.

Preventing Mold Before It Starts
Control humidity with dehumidifiers, especially in basements and crawl spaces. Aim for 30-50% relative humidity—critical in our NJ summers and damp falls.
Ensure proper ventilation in bathrooms, kitchens, and attics. Exhaust fans should vent outdoors, not into attics (a common mistake in Middlebush or Forsgate homes).
Address water intrusion immediately. Even small leaks in roofs or pipes can lead to major mold problems over time. Regularly check for condensation on windows or pipes in areas like Keasbey or Deans.
What to Do If You Find Mold
Do not disturb it. Scrubbing or bleaching mold can release spores into the air, worsening contamination. This is especially risky in enclosed spaces like crawl spaces or attics.
Isolate the area by closing doors or using plastic sheeting. Turn off HVAC systems to prevent spore spread. Then, contact a certified mold remediation team for a thorough assessment.

Frequently Asked Questions
Can I just bleach mold to kill it?
Bleach only removes surface mold and doesn’t address the root cause—moisture. It also doesn’t kill mold spores embedded in porous materials like drywall or wood. Professional remediation is needed for thorough, safe removal.
How quickly can mold grow after water damage?
Mold can begin growing within 24-48 hours of water exposure. In our humid climate, this timeline is often even shorter. Immediate action is critical to prevent colonization.
Is black mold the only toxic mold I should worry about?
No. While Stachybotrys (black mold) is highly toxic, other molds like Aspergillus, Penicillium, and Fusarium can also pose serious health risks. Professional testing identifies the specific type and severity.

What’s the difference between mold testing and inspection?
An inspection visually assesses for mold and moisture issues. Testing involves collecting air or surface samples for lab analysis to identify mold types and spore counts. Both are often needed for a complete picture.
Can mold return after remediation?
Yes, if the underlying moisture problem isn’t fixed. Effective remediation includes identifying and addressing the source of water intrusion, followed by thorough cleaning and prevention measures.
